Born in Milano in 1955, Cino Zucchi earned a B.S.A.D. at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(Cambridge, Mass.) in 1978 and a Laurea in Architettura at the Politecnico di Milano in 1979, where he is currently Chair Professor of Architectural and Urban Design. He has been Visiting Professor at the Harvard Graduate School of Design in 2013. He is regularly invited to give lectures and sits on architectural juries both in Italy and abroad.
